‘The Young and the Restless’ Star Shares Unfiltered Thoughts on Cane Recast

24 June 20253 Mins Read

One of The Young and the Restless most popular couples of the 2010s was Cane Ashby (Daniel Goddard) and Lily Winters (Christel Khalil). Their love story came to a complete end when Daniel Goddard exited the role, but now things could be turning around as Billy Flynn steps in as the new Cane. Khalil is now addressing the return of her former on-screen husband head-on, sharing her thoughts on of the storyline, when she found out Cane was returning, and asking fans to give this version of Cane and Lily a chance.

Khalil joined The Young and the Restless in 2002, as the teenage daughter of Drucilla and Neil Winters, though she was biologically Neil’s half brother Malcom’s daughter. Throughout her time on the show Lily has traditionally driven story, but that hasn’t been the case for her recently, as Lily has had a little less to do in recent years. “I’ve been wanting to be used more, so it’s great to be working a lot more and have something to really sink my teeth into. For a long time, it’s been mainly a business storyline, which has been really fun to play and work with Victor, but it’s nice to have that other layer of emotion and relationship and connection to play as well.” The actress shared with TV Insider.

The actress wasn’t told what her upcoming storyline would be, or even more importantly that her on-screen husband would be making a dramatic return. “Josh Griffith kept it a secret for a very long time, I didn’t realize they were bringing Cane back until a week or two before he started. I was super excited; it was such a great character, and it was a shame to not have the character there.”

This will be the first time Khalil will have worked with co-star Billy Flynn. The actress shared, “I heard great things from some of the other cast members who had either worked with him or knew people that worked with him, he’s such a great guy and great to work with.”

Khalil sent a direct message that they are not trying to undo her previous co-star Daniel Goddards work, but rather expand and show a new perspective. The actress explained, “I think the good thing that Josh has done is he’s completely changed the character of Cane. It doesn’t feel like we’re trying to have someone step in Daniel Goddards shoes, It’s pretty much an entirely new character, so it’s been interesting to have scenes because we have the history there, but it’s a little bit different. They’ve also added in flashbacks that Lily has of interactions that she and Cane have had in the past, five or six years. So, it’s almost a little bit of a new relationship again, in a way.”

The actress continued to ask fans to give this story and interpretation of Cane a chance. She said, “At the end of the day, it’s not going to be the same Cane. It’s a completely different person, and I really hope that everybody gives Billy a chance and tries to look at the character through new eyes, because it is a new person, and honestly, it’s a new character. He’s nothing like Daniel Goddard, and that’s kind of the point. The point was to make this character something completely different. And so hopefully people give it a chance and look at it like a new relationship rather than like an old one coming back.”

The Young and the Restless airs weekdays on CBS and streams weeknights on Paramount+.
